Agency application on ecological sustainability

About the application

The current export approval for the Commonwealth North West Slope and Western Deepwater Trawl fisheries is valid until 30 June 2017 and the fishery is now due for assessment for ongoing export accreditation. The Department of the Environment and Energy received an application, ‘Submission for reassessment of export approval under the EPBC Act, North West Slope and Western Deepwater Trawl fisheries’, from the Australian Fisheries Management Authority in September 2016. The application has been prepared to address the Australian Government ‘Guidelines for the ecologically sustainable management of fisheries – 2nd edition’ and to provide updates on the implementation of recommendations made in the previous Australian Government assessment. The application will be used to assess the operation of the fishery for the purposes of Parts 13 and 13A of the Environment Protection and Biodiversity Conservation Act 1999 (EPBC Act).

Consideration will be given to:

  • declaring the Commonwealth North West Slope and Western Deepwater Trawl fisheries, as managed consistent with the Commonwealth Fisheries Management Act 1991 and the Fisheries Management Regulations 1992, as an approved wildlife trade operation under section 303FN of the EPBC Act, and
  • including in the list of exempt native specimens, specimens harvested in the Commonwealth North West Slope and Western Deepwater Trawl fisheries under the provisions of the Commonwealth Fisheries Management Act 1991 and the Fisheries Management Regulations 1992.

In accordance with the provisions of sections 303FR and 303DC of the EPBC Act, you are invited to comment on this proposal.
